1.The report Crp is c reactive protein which would indicate any underlying infection,arthritis,or any underlying damage or organ dysfunction or disorder.The report is normal .
2.Erythrocyte sedimentation Rate is slightly higher .Need not worry.
Symptoms and history if any is required to guide further.
